Kolibri Global Energy Inc. reports developments for a North American oil and gas producer with U.S. energy properties, including shale oil and gas operations and the Tishomingo field in Oklahoma. Its updates commonly address drilling programs, well performance, production volumes, independent reserve evaluations, and financial results tied to commodity prices and capital spending.
Company news also covers balance-sheet actions such as revolving credit facility updates for Kolibri Energy US Inc., shareholder returns, annual meeting results, director nominations, and other governance matters. Kolibri's common shares trade on the Toronto Stock Exchange as KEI and on Nasdaq as KGEI.
Kolibri Global Energy announced an impressive 2023 with a net income of US$19.3 million and Adjusted EBITDA of $39.1 million. The company saw significant increases in production and revenues, with a positive growth outlook for 2024. However, Total Proved Reserves decreased by 6%, impacting the NPV10. Despite lower average prices, higher production and lower costs contributed to the positive financial results. The company's debt-to-Adjusted EBITDA ratio was 0.68, indicating manageable debt levels.
